Output 96f15315727cf380ec656fe63875470f18401d887594254545acc41cce40b73f:21

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5914984edba77c3bb6de95e89a9db77bd6e0e678 OP_EQUAL
address
9zZHURcFMTSD3SJ3XY7zLywQsUr3DUD7Am
transaction
96f15315727cf380ec656fe63875470f18401d887594254545acc41cce40b73f